Job description

This newly created position is an exciting opportunity to play a crucial role in the safeguarding of pupils at Norwich High School for Girls.

Norwich High School for Girls understands that the increasing responsibility of safeguarding pupils is of paramount importance and the Designated Safeguarding Lead and Attendance Officer will recognise the scope and significance of the School’s role in safeguarding children of all ages.

The postholder will be responsible for safeguarding children across the school (from age 3-18) and will work with staff to create an effective safeguarding culture. They will develop relations with pupils, their parents, local safeguarding partners, and other relevant bodies and advise and support members of staff on child welfare, safeguarding and child protection matters.

The ideal candidate will require relevant professional qualifications or experience in the field of safeguarding as well as knowledge of legislation and guidance on safeguarding and working with young people.

About Norwich High School for Girls

Norwich High School for Girls was founded in 1875 and is an independent day school for girls from 3-18 with approximately 600 pupils. The school is part of the Girls’ Day School Trust (GDST), the largest independent school group in the UK. It is at the forefront of education for girls and a strong voice in promoting opportunities for young women.
